2. Introduction
In addition to teaching medicine, Dr. Bryan
Schneider treats breast cancer patients at Indiana
University Hospital in Indianapolis. Dr. Bryan
Schneider is also a member of the Komen
Scholars.
Formerly known as the Scientific Advisory Council
(SAC), the Komen Scholars are a group of 60
notable researchers and advisors dealing with
breast cancer research for the Susan G. Komen
for the Cure. These members have either made
noteworthy advancements within the field or
assisted with other cancer-based projects.
3. About
As the leading private funder for breast cancer
research around the globe, the Susan G. Komen for
the Cure has raised more than $2 billion to help those
in more than 50 countries. Established in 1982, the
foundation relies on assistance from volunteers,
researchers, and doctors, all of whom share a
common vision for finding a breast cancer cure.
The Komen Scholars consist of 54 individuals who
search for cures for cancer, as well as six other
individuals who serve as advocates of science and
help to reduce the burden of breast cancer within a
community. Collectively, the Komen Scholars pave the
way for innovative breast cancer research and quality
care.
